Middle-income earners (M40) say Budget 2026 offers limited relief as they struggle with rising costs, stagnant wages, and shrinking disposable income. While targeted measures like Budi95 and tax breaks exist, many fall outside aid eligibility and feel overlooked.
M40 Malaysians Feel Left Out
Working parents cite mounting childcare and education expenses, while others call for practical support like flexible tax deductions.
The gap between B40 and lower M40 is narrowing, yet many feel trapped between aid for the poor and privileges for the rich. Despite some positive steps, M40 families say the budget lacks balance and fails to address structural pressures they face daily.
